How they compare

Serbia and Montenegro currently reports 0.47 ha/cap against 0.17 ha/cap in Western Europe, a difference of 0.3 ha/cap.

That makes Serbia and Montenegro's figure about 2.8 times Western Europe's.

Across all 14 years both countries report, Serbia and Montenegro has been ahead every year.

Serbia and Montenegro ranks 21st and Western Europe ranks 21st of 216 countries.

Serbia and Montenegro has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The FAOSTAT Land Use domain contains data on twenty-one land use categories and twenty-three categories of irrigation and agricultural practices. Data are available yearly and by country, regional and global levels. The domain includes Land Use Indicators providing information on the percentage share of agricultural and forest land, and their sub-components, including irrigated areas and areas under organic agriculture, within a country land use matrix. Data are available at country, regional and global level, for the following elements: (in percentage) i) Share in Land area; ii) Share in Agricultural land, iii) Share in Cropland; and iv) Share in Forest land; (in ha/pc) v) Area per capita.
